[英]Default read and connection timeouts for reactor-netty HttpClient
[英]per connection timeouts in netty
我正在使用 netty 编写客户端应用程序,我想为每个连接设置一个连接超时。 现在我正在做类似的事情:
Bootstrap bootstrap = new Bootstrap();
bootstrap.group(new EpollEventLoopGroup(1)).channel(EpollSocketChannel.class);
bootstrap.option(ChannelOption.CONNECT_TIMEOUT_MILLIS, connectionTimeoutSecs * 1000);
bootstrap.handler(new EmptyChannelInitializer());
这似乎在全球范围内有效,但是有没有办法为每个连接指定某些内容? 我在bootstrap.connect()
方法中没有看到这样做的机会。
您可以通过channel.config().setOption(...)
在initChannel(...)
方法中设置它,或者只是创建一个新的引导程序(可以共享相同的EventLoopGroup
。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.